CEO Succession Planning: A Comprehensive Guide for a Seamless Leadership Transition in 2024

Share

CEO Succession Planning: Your 2024 Comprehensive Guide (+Free Template)

CEO succession planning is critical for the sustainability and success of any organization. An unanticipated CEO departure or mismanaged transition can erode market value, diminish investor confidence, and disrupt operations. In contrast, a meticulously crafted succession plan enhances organizational resilience and ensures leadership continuity.

What Is CEO Succession Planning?

CEO succession planning isn’t merely about choosing a successor; it’s a strategic endeavor aimed at safeguarding the organization’s future. This process encompasses identifying potential leaders, preparing them through training and development, and orchestrating a seamless transition of leadership.

Essential Steps in Developing a CEO Succession Plan

To develop a sound CEO succession plan, organizations must engage in a detailed, multi-step process:

  1. Start Early: Begin planning for the next CEO as soon as possible, identifying and grooming potential successors from within the organization.
  2. CEO Success Profile: Craft a detailed profile that outlines the necessary skills, experience, and behavioral traits required of your future CEO, ensuring alignment with organizational goals.
  3. Contingency Planning: Prepare for unexpected CEO departures by developing interim leadership arrangements and identifying internal and external candidates.
  4. Successor Identification and Development: Utilize assessments to identify potential successors within your organization, offering them personalized development opportunities.
  5. Communication: Ensure transparency in the succession process by openly discussing it with potential successors.
  6. Inclusion of External Candidates: Don’t overlook the value external candidates might bring, especially if the organization seeks radical change or innovation.

New CEO Transition Checklist

Transitioning to a new CEO is pivotal. Whether promoting an internal candidate or bringing in an outsider, HR must ensure a smooth assimilation into the organization. This involves understanding the unique needs of both scenarios and providing appropriate support.

Free CEO Succession Planning Template

To facilitate this complex process, a CEO succession planning template is invaluable. This tool should enumerate the selection criteria and detail the requisite skills and experiences to helm the company, setting the stage for successful leadership transitions.

CEO Succession Planning Best Practices

For a successful CEO succession plan, consider the following best practices:

  • Establish Open Communication: Engage in frank discussions with the current CEO about succession goals, encouraging them to mentor potential successors.
  • Board and Investor Involvement: Create a board committee dedicated to overseeing succession planning, incorporating external consultants for an unbiased perspective.
  • Leadership Development: Empower potential candidates through interim leadership roles and regular talent assessments, adhering to DEIB principles.
  • Have a Contingency Plan: An emergency plan for unexpected CEO departures ensures stability and maintains confidence among stakeholders.

Effective CEO succession planning is a pivotal safety net for organizations, enabling them to manage leadership transitions seamlessly. By collaborating with the board, current CEO, and leveraging strategic planning tools, HR professionals can guide their organizations through these changes, securing its legacy and future success.
